Amy Chong
I had heard of Da Seafood Cartel but didn’t know we’d be passing by this location, so I made us turn around to go back and stop in for a snack.

Everyone working there was so nice and friendly and helpful. We ordered the ceviche (which comes with tostadas) and a crab and tobiko spread. It was so good and refreshing!! I’ve never had tostadas so thin. They were unbelievably crispy and the perfect vehicle for the dip and ceviche together. One of the best bites we had during our trip. I wish we’d had the stomach capacity to try more from them.

They have some seating inside and a couple small tables outside. Definitely recommend you stop by if you can!!

Michael L
I have tried ceviche before and haven’t loved it, always too many onions for me. I have also never had a poke bowl. The reviews were so great at this place so I decided to go and try something different.

I ordered the Tostada La Basta. Probably the best seafood/shellfish dish I have ever had. Absolutely phenomenal in every way. People wait in 50+ person lines to eat out of a food truck like Giovanni’s just a block down and they are missing the boat here by skipping this place. A must try when you visit Haleiwa.

Miranda Evangelista
My husband and I went to seafood cartel last weekend. It looked nice, very clean, and staff were very friendly HOWEVER we got horrible food poisoning. We each ordered something different (og tostada and poke nachos) and didn’t even taste each other’s food. So both foods were contaminated and were different foods entirely. We wanted to like this place but simply cannot recommend a restaurant that caused us to throw up for 24 hours straight 🙁
